BOZEMAN, Montana, Nov. 19 [TNSmedicalresearch-Journal of Medical Internet Research] -- Montana State University issued the following news:
A program delivered entirely online that aims to reduce depression and anxiety symptoms has shown promising results in a new Montana State University study.
